Mobile Hydrogen Generator - Power Electronics Design
Budget: €5,000 – €10,000 EUR
Guidance and hands-on support are required to take a power electronics system (DC-DC & DC-AC) for a hydrogen generator application from concept to a build-ready design. The immediate goal is to select an appropriate topology, model its behaviour, size the magnetics and passive components, and confirm thermal and EMI performance against typical conditions.
The work will revolve around power electronics simulation and schematic capture, and clear documentation, ready for production. Access to prior converter experience—especially with transient immunity and load-dump scenarios—will be valuable.
Deliverables
• Complete, validated schematic with reference designators and values
• Simulation files showing steady-state and transient performance
• Bill of materials listing readily available (automotive-grade) parts
• Concise design report summarising key calculations, losses, thermal margins, and compliance notes
All files should be editable and accompanied by brief walkthrough notes so that future tweaks can be made easily.
